Job Summary
The Stone Center for Inequality Dynamics (CID) at the University of Michigan is seeking a full-time, in-residence Engagement Manager. The successful candidate will bring a creative approach to communications and outreach for a growing and dynamic research center with a strong public-facing presence.
CID is a relatively new research and training program within the Survey Research Center at the Institute for Social Research dedicated to producing cutting-edge research on social inequality in a supportive intellectual community. The Stone Center examines how between-group inequalities are shaped by geographic, political, and institutional contexts. As an organization, CID seeks to create a democratic and inclusive environment that communicates its research to a broad audience.
For details, please see https://inequality.umich.edu/.
We are looking for a communications professional to promote and communicate the efforts of CID and its affiliates to a broad public, the larger University of Michigan community, and the center's collaborators, affiliates, and team. The Engagement Manager will create and coordinate a strategy to increase CID's visibility and engagement through both established and emerging communication tools and tactics, including website and social media content, video formats, data visualization, print media, and more. We are looking for a person who is creative, energetic, and has the ability to connect with a diverse set of stakeholders. This person is willing to try new things, can work independently as part of a team, is highly dependable, and has a positive attitude.
Communications Management & Strategy (35%)
- Develop and implement CID's communications strategy, taking into account internal and external stakeholders, market trends, and users' needs.
- Understand and co-develop CID's goals, vision, and organizational culture.
- Measure and report on the effectiveness of communication strategies and tactics including data analytics reports on open rates, Google Analytics, traffic and engagement, user experience, stakeholder satisfaction, etc.
- Increase CID's public profile and visibility by working with Michigan News and other news outlets/journalists to distribute releases and promote research findings.
- Identify and develop relationships with news outlets and journalists to promote research findings.
- Collaborate with communications professionals at U-M, ISR, and peer institutions to increase the public profile and visibility of CID's work and events.
- Connect with campus communications professionals to make CID's work visible on campus and to associate CID activities with Michigan efforts.
- Manage freelancers and vendors for marketing and communications projects including events, design, and multimedia projects.
Internal and Employee Communications (15%)
- Update and expand CID contacts database and mailing lists.
- Provide constructive feedback and media coaching to faculty and affiliates as needed.
- Participate in internal team meetings to understand priorities and promote activities as appropriate to various audiences through social media, website, video, and print.
- Coordinate content for team meetings, such as slides and agendas.
- Create branded templates and other external branding materials for use at conferences and research presentations.
Community Engagement and Outreach (50%)
- Publicize CID events and lecture series, including marketing campaigns and communication strategies.
- Increase CID's visibility across campus.
- Develop and manage research and center content for web, social media, video, newsletters, and press. Ensure all content and communications are compelling, accurate, accessible, and appropriate for various audiences, stakeholders, and platforms.
- Conduct interviews with affiliates to help communicate their research findings. Publish and promote CID research experts' findings through public relations, social media, and the broader research community.
- Create, print, and publish marketing and event materials throughout the year including an annual report, external e-newsletter, event invitations, articles, and more.
- Develop and execute social media strategy for multiple social platforms, including LinkedIn, BlueSky, YouTube, and other emerging platforms.
